Looking Back – Illinois’ frontier seminary 

Illinois became a state in 1818, but was still very much a frontier state in the 1830s. 

Illinois’ rough and tumble frontier status did not deter Rev. Philander Chase from planning to open a theological seminary on the prairie. As the first bishop of the Episcopal Diocese of Illinois, Chase was in a position to turn his dream into a reality.
